 (5) Type 2 systems (Ref. Fig. 006) Systems with an ARINC 429 output and a discrete input. Type 2 systems are not capable of memorizing data concerning faults that they detect beyond the last flight. Schematically, a Type 2 system BITE consists of 4 zones of non-volatile memory (EEPROM):
 -
Zone 1 : This zone is used for storing the identity of the LRU declared faulty during the current or the last flight.

 -
Zone 2 : This zone is used for storing complementary data concerning faults occured during the current or the last flight. This zone is only accessible in the workshop.

 -
Zone 3 : This zone is used to store the identity of faulty LRUs, for faults that occurred on the ground during the last line stop.

 -
Zone 4 : This zone is used for storing more detailed data concerning the faults (parts of the LRU). This zone is only accessible in the workshop.

 Memorization of faults in these memories and transmission of these
 data to the CFDIU is carried out according to a single operating
 mode, Normal Mode.
 The input discrete is used to initialize a ground test.
